Output d743ff6d39bc63ef90dd69ed895f2aff8f9bbdc266646119bee058540d2d2870:1

value
54557668
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15f53fd62084634c1ed0bd5eff98e446c535352e OP_EQUAL
address
33h7uo9oB5eMaBtL69RpLBafmyMfz7TwTf
transaction
d743ff6d39bc63ef90dd69ed895f2aff8f9bbdc266646119bee058540d2d2870
spent
true